Our Material Handling Group is currently looking for a full time Forklift Field Service Technician/Mechanic for our Lewiston, ME branch. This position is first shift, M – F, and hourly (no flat rate!). Field Technicians are provided a company service van, which is provided for our Techs to drive home (you don’t leave it at our shop at the end of the day), along with a fuel card. The primary responsibilities of the position consist of, but are not limited to:

Performing preventative maintenance on customer forklifts and other material handling equipment
Diagnose and repair all forms of customer equipment
Completing each repair job in a timely, efficient and professional manner
Providing exceptional customer service
Work and manage workloads independently
Proper completion and submission of all required paperwork
Field Technicians are responsible for company vehicle and on-board parts inventory
Incorporate Alta’s Guiding Principles into daily activities
Performs other duties as assigned
Consistent, regular, and reliable attendance including being ready for work at the designated start time

Qualifications:

Qualifications: Two years of previous forklift repair experience is highly desired, which includes experience in the Military, Guard or Reserve with an MOS or NEC code of 63B, 63H, 63S, 63W, 63Y, 91B, 91H, 91L, 91M or CM. Previous field experience is highly preferable. Strong working knowledge of electric and liquid propane units. Excellent mechanical aptitude. Possess own tools. Must have clean driving record and valid driver’s license to drive company vehicle. Computer programs - HYPASS, Hyster TKC training software and Yale/Hyster contact management system. Language Skills - Intermediate: Ability to read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ions, and procedure manuals. Ability to write routine reports and correspondence. Ability to speak effectively before groups of customers or employees of the organization. Mathematical Skills - Basic: Ability to add and subtract two digit numbers and to multiply and divide with 10's and 100's. Ability to perform these operations using units of American money and weight measurement, volume, and distance. Reasoning Ability - Intermediate: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ral, or diagram form. Ability to deal with problems involving several concrete variables in standardized situations. Physical Demands/Work Environment: Physical/Sensory Functions: Regularly will stand, walk, use hands, reach with hands; Frequently will talk/hear; Occasionally will sit, climb or balance, st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l. Vision: No special vision requirements. Lift and/or Move Functions: Regularly will lift up to 10 pounds; Frequently will lift 11 to 25 pounds; Occasionally will lift from 26 to 100 plus pounds. Work Environment: Regularly will work near moving mechanical parts; Frequently will be exposed to fumes or airborne particles, outdoor weather conditions; Occasionally will work in wet or humid conditions (non-weather), extreme cold and heat (non-weather), risk of electrical shock, vibration.
